About Wolfe Middle School
Wolfe Middle School is a regular public middle school in Center Line, Michigan, located in Macomb County. Situated at 8640 McKinley Road, the school serves students from sixth through eighth grade with an enrollment of 513 students. The student-teacher ratio is 17.1:1, supported by 30 full-time equivalent teachers.
Wolfe Middle School is situated in a large suburban area that offers a variety of resources and amenities. Academically, Wolfe Middle School has a MySchoolScout rating of 6.3 out of 10, placing it at the 67th percentile among Michigan schools with a state ranking of #1071 out of 3204. Students perform particularly well in English Language Arts and Reading, with 37% achieving proficiency or above, while math proficiency is lower, with only 20% of students meeting or exceeding the standard.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has improved from 16% (2019) to 22.22%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has improved from 31% (2019) to 40.96%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Wolfe Middle School has a median household income of $52,857. It is a community where 19%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$145,300, with a median rent of $627/month. The area has a poverty rate of 12.6%. The average commute for residents is 21 minutes.
